A Kelowna medical aesthetics company and a fitness provider are teaming up for a worthy cause this Christmas.
Kelowna Medical Aesthetics and SpinCo have joined forces on a fundraiser involving over 40 local businesses to raise funds to help support four Indigenous families that have been affected by Residential Schools in the past. “We will be giving each family a wholesome Christmas of presents, food, and tree,” states a press release.
Owner Suzette Sandrin says her company has partnered with fellow local business Michelle August owner of SpinCo and together they have created a fundraiser with over 40 local businesses participating to support the cause.
If you want to help support the cause, Okanagan residents can purchase a $25 ticket, for a chance to win
one of a large number of prizes, so far, over $10,000 of prizes have been donated. SpinCo are giving a 3 month unlimited pass worth $550 and their floor model Podium $1,999, and of course, treatments from Kelowna Medical Aesthetics.
